I was wondering if the connector in the picture (near my thumb) looks familiar to anyone? This is an NEC nl6448bc20-08 panel, with the CCFL assembly removed. It's a 6.5" true VGA panel w/ 250:1 aspect ratio.

I had hoped to buy a digitalview controller and use this for a small panel projector with a Delta IV and cropping, but this connector is getting in my way. The ribbon cable going to it is too short for the PCB to be flipped down when it is connected. I'm beginning to think it is a bust (no biggie, just 30 dollars down the tubes). It looks as if it has about 250 pins in a connector no bigger than half of my thumbnail (included is a picture of my thumb for reference). I still like to entertain the thought of it still being useable w/ an extension cable of some sort, considering it is not directly soldered to the glass.
